Anthony Snow
About Anthony Snow
Anthony Snow is an Instrumentation & Electrical Technician at ExxonMobil with a diverse background in production, assembly, and loan origination. He holds multiple degrees in technical fields from Joliet Junior College and DeVry University.

Current Role at ExxonMobil
Anthony Snow has been working at ExxonMobil since 2017, where he serves as an Instrumentation & Electrical Technician. In this role, he is responsible for maintaining and troubleshooting instrumentation and electrical systems to ensure operational efficiency.
Previous Work Experience
Prior to his current role, Anthony Snow worked in several noteworthy positions. From 2013 to 2017, he was a Production Operator at Nestle USA. Before that, he served as an Assembler and Test Specialist at Caterpillar Inc. from 2010 to 2013 in Joliet, Illinois. He also gained experience as an Assembler at Ford Motor Company from 2007 to 2009 in Chicago, Illinois. Additionally, Anthony held the position of Loan Originator at Quality Mortgage Lending from 2005 to 2006.
Educational Background
Anthony Snow has a strong educational foundation with multiple degrees. He completed an Associate of Arts and Sciences in Process Control Instrumentation Technology from Joliet Junior College in 2018. Previously, he earned an Associate of Arts and Sciences in Electrical/Electronics and Automated Systems from the same college in 2017. Furthermore, he holds a Bachelor of Applied Science in Network Communications/Technical Management, which he obtained from DeVry University in 2010.
